I wrote earlier about IBM's high density Blue Gene/P data center that is a state of the art HPC system fitting tons of computing power into a small space.  It pushes the envelope in a number of ways, including how to keep it cool, and how to provide enough power at such high density.

This weekend, the New York Times Magazine profiled Watson, the system running on the Blue Gene/P cluster at the T.J. Watson Research Center in order to take on humans at Jeopardy!  The article is lengthy, but the video is equally entertaining.

IBM has their own website too that explains Watson.
